As much as I cringe at most of the work I was creating back then, I did a ton of it. I was starting a 2nd comic strip as well as delving head first into marker illustrations. This was about a year or so before I would become familiar with Adobe Illustrator and Photoshop. This art was strictly cut and paste in the crudest sense.



I'd always loved the texture of Design Markers® and the watercolor effect they usually produced! As far as gradients went, I was never proficient with an airbrush, and usually opted for spray paint on the paper whenever I needed anything close to a gradient.



Trouble was, often times something I'd spent days pencilling and inking would be trashed due to terrible color choices and would result in just being heartbroken. As a result, I usually stayed safe and would only use lighter colors.




1993 was pivotal, as, it really marked the end of my 'color markers' era and opened me up to the world of digital tools and coloring. As a friend of mine once noted "you'll never use your color markers again." He was right!
